My MIL Kept Snooping Through My Packages – Until I Taught Her a Lesson She’ll Never Forget

Five months pregnant and eager to create the perfect life, Cecelia only has one problem: her meddling mother-in-law, Martha. Martha has a bad habit of opening Cecelia’s packages without permission, but when she ruins the surprise of Cecelia’s gender reveal, Cecelia decides to teach her a lesson. She orders two packages—a glitter bomb and a highly embarrassing adult toy—knowing Martha won’t be able to resist snooping.

When Martha opens them, chaos erupts: glitter covers everything, and Martha is humiliated. Caught on the security camera, her antics are later shared with the entire family, exposing her lies when she tries to twist the story. From that day forward, every delivery remains untouched, and Martha earns a new nickname: The Package Bandit. Cecelia finally gets her peace—and a little sweet revenge.
